This is a True First Edition, First Printing of On Growing Up: His Letters From and To American Children by the 31st President of the United States, Herbert Hoover (1962, William Morrow and Company).
The Peltier Association: This specific volume is an Association Copy, inscribed by President Hoover to noted Pacific Northwest historian and rare book dealer Jerome Peltier (1911–2004). Peltier was a distinguished author of 15 books and the long-time proprietor of Clark’s Old Book Store in Spokane. This book represents a direct link between the President and a key figure in the preservation of Western American history.
